stock market web service

The Insider's Guide To Developing Stock Market Web Service

Photo of author

By service

As you commence on the journey of developing a stock market web service, you'll find that mastering the intricacies of data integration and security protocols is paramount. By understanding the nuances of user authentication and data visualization, you can create a platform that not only meets industry standards but also exceeds user expectations. The key lies in blending innovation with reliability, ensuring that your service stands out in a competitive market. But remember, the true essence of success in this domain lies in the delicate balance between cutting-edge technology and user-centric design.

Understanding Stock Market Web Service Development

To understand Stock Market Web Service Development, you must grasp key concepts such as real-time data provision and secure trading interfaces.

Exploring the technological stack involved in these services will give you insight into the tools and systems required for seamless functionality.

Mastering these points is essential for creating a successful and compliant platform in the dynamic world of financial markets.

Key Concepts in Stock Market Web Service Development

To understand the key concepts in stock market web service development, you must grasp the significance of API integration and data feeds. APIs allow seamless communication between different systems, enabling the exchange of information essential for real-time stock market data.

Data feeds provide the continuous flow of market information necessary for traders to make informed decisions and execute trades efficiently.

API Integration and Data Feeds

Implementing API integration in stock market web service development is essential for facilitating real-time data feeds and ensuring access to accurate market information.

Data feeds from APIs provide vital stock market data such as prices, volumes, and trends to users. This integration enables seamless communication between the website and external sources like exchanges and financial institutions, aiding in informed decision-making for stock trading.

Technological Stack for Stock Market Web Service

When considering the technological stack for your stock market web service, database management and security measures play a critical role in ensuring data integrity and protection.

Proper implementation of database management systems like MySQL, PostgreSQL, or MongoDB is essential for storing and accessing financial data reliably.

Additionally, incorporating robust security measures such as encryption, access controls, and regular audits is crucial to safeguard sensitive information from potential threats.

Database Management and Security Measures

Developing a stock market web service requires a robust database management system and stringent security measures to safeguard sensitive financial data and user information.

Implementing encryption techniques and secure protocols is essential to guarantee data confidentiality and integrity.

Regular data backups and disaster recovery plans are paramount for preventing data loss.

Additionally, incorporating multi-factor authentication and access controls enhances security against unauthorized access, while compliance with industry regulations maintains user data security.

Implementing Stock Market Web Service

You'll need to focus on designing a user interface that effectively visualizes stock market data for users.

Back-end development will be essential for integrating algorithms that provide accurate and real-time financial information.

Implementing these components will be key in creating a robust stock market web service that meets user needs efficiently.

Designing User Interface for Stock Market Data Visualization

You need to focus on integrating real-time data updates and advanced charting tools into your stock market web service interface. These features will provide users with accurate and timely information on stock prices and market trends.

Real-time Data Updates and Charting Tools

Implementing real-time data updates and advanced charting tools in stock market web services greatly enhances user engagement, trading activity, and decision-making capabilities.

Real-time data can increase user engagement by 20%, while tools like candlestick charts and moving averages aid in trend identification.

Interactive features reduce bounce rates by 25%, and customizable tools boost user satisfaction by 30%.

Technical indicators such as MACD and RSI further empower traders in analyzing market trends.

Back-end Development and Algorithm Implementation

You need to focus on algorithmic trading strategies and risk management when it comes to back-end development and algorithm implementation in stock market websites.

Implementing efficient algorithms can help in automating trading processes and optimizing risk management strategies.

Algorithmic Trading Strategies and Risk Management

Utilizing algorithmic trading strategies and robust risk management tools is imperative in the development of a stock market web service. Particularly when focusing on back-end development and algorithm implementation.

  1. Algorithmic trading strategies automate buy/sell decisions based on specific criteria.
  2. Risk management tools help control and mitigate potential losses in trading.
  3. Back-end development involves creating server-side logic and database management.

Testing and Deployment of Stock Market Web Service

When testing a stock market web service, you need to focus on quality assurance and performance testing to guarantee data accuracy and secure transactions.

Optimizing deployment strategies is essential for fast loading and seamless user experience.

Implementing continuous integration practices helps maintain stability and reliability in stock market web services.

Quality Assurance and Performance Testing

When it comes to quality assurance and performance testing for stock market web services, load testing and scalability measures play a critical role.

Load testing assesses how the web service performs under high user traffic, ensuring it can handle the workload efficiently.

Scalability measures help determine if the system can adapt and grow to meet increasing demands without compromising performance.

Load Testing and Scalability Measures

To guarantee the reliability and efficiency of your stock market web service, load testing and scalability measures must be implemented effectively.

  1. Conduct thorough load testing to confirm the website can handle high traffic volumes and user loads efficiently.
  2. Implement scalability measures to accommodate increased demand as your user base grows.
  3. Regular performance testing is essential to maintaining a responsive, fast, and reliable website under varying conditions.

Deployment Strategies and Continuous Integration

You should consider utilizing cloud hosting services and monitoring solutions to enhance the scalability and performance of your stock market web service.

Implementing cloud hosting can provide flexibility in resource allocation and improve the overall reliability of your service.

Monitoring solutions offer real-time insights into the health of your application, aiding in the quick detection and resolution of any issues that may arise.

Cloud Hosting and Monitoring Solutions

Cloud hosting and monitoring solutions play a pivotal role in guaranteeing the scalability, performance, and security of stock market web services.

Cloud hosting offers scalability and flexibility for handling fluctuating user traffic efficiently.

Monitoring solutions ensure peak performance and security by detecting and resolving issues in real-time.

Deployment strategies like blue-green deployment enable smooth updates and rollbacks without downtime.

Securing Stock Market Web Service

Implementing robust data encryption protocols and ensuring compliance with financial regulations are essential steps in securing your stock market web service.

Additionally, utilizing multi-factor authentication and stringent access controls can help fortify user accounts against unauthorized access.

Data Encryption and Regulatory Compliance

You must prioritize compliance with regulations like GDPR and financial industry standards in your stock market web service.

Ensuring that your platform adheres to these guidelines is essential for protecting user data and upholding legal integrity.

GDPR and Financial Industry Standards

Data encryption and compliance with GDPR and financial industry standards are critical components in securing stock market web services.

Financial institutions must adhere to GDPR regulations to protect client data.

Industry standards like PCI DSS and ISO 27001 guarantee safe handling of financial information.

Encryption protocols such as SSL/TLS are essential for securing data in transit on stock market websites.

User Authentication and Access Control

You should prioritize implementing two-factor authentication (2FA) to enhance user verification and security on your stock market web service.

Secure endpoints play an important role in controlling access and protecting sensitive data from unauthorized users.

Two-factor Authentication and Secure Endpoints

Implementing two-factor authentication and secure endpoints is essential for enhancing the security of a stock market web service. This ensures that only authorized users can access sensitive financial data.

Two-factor authentication adds an extra layer of security.

Secure endpoints restrict access to specific parts of the service.

User authentication helps prevent unauthorized access and protects financial data.